**Ticket LEDG-2214: Config drift on payroll export nodes**

The Tallygrove payroll exporter switched to the v3 column format last sprint, but two of the four export nodes are still emitting v2 headers. Drift likely came from a manual hotfix that bypassed the deploy pipeline. Please reconcile the nodes against the canonical settings shown below.

deployment values, kajep-kageg:
[praix]
host = praix.paliqcorp.corp
user = praix_svc
database = praix_prod

Subject: DR drill results — Quicktype autocomplete index

For future maintainers: during yesterday's disaster-recovery drill, rebuilding the Quicktype autocomplete index took 94 minutes, well over target. Root cause was cold shard caches on the standby cluster. We've documented a pre-warm step in the drill runbook. Restoring the index snapshot requires unsealing the backup archive, for which the recovery passphrase is:

unlock words, hahip-baduf: holwyn-istath-julvan

# Runbook: Hunting leaked file descriptors in Quillgate

When the `fd_open` gauge climbs steadily between deploys, suspect a leak rather than load. First confirm on a single pod: exec in and count entries under `/proc/1/fd`, noting how many are sockets in CLOSE_WAIT versus regular files. Capture two snapshots ten minutes apart before restarting anything — we need the delta for the postmortem. Reproduce locally with the Marbury load harness, which requires the service running with the following configuration values.

settings of yagep-bajog:
[istdor]
port = 4000
region = south-2
host = istdor.qorvelcorp.internal
timeout_ms = 5000
retries = 5

Leadership Review Briefing — Annual Billing Transition

For department heads: Corvale Systems proposes moving Lanternbase subscriptions from monthly to annual billing starting next fiscal year. Modeling shows improved cash position and reduced churn-related admin load, offset by a near-term revenue recognition dip and likely pushback from smaller accounts. Support and Sales should prepare migration scripts and discount guidance. Legal has cleared the revised terms. The strategic rationale behind the timing is summarized in the note below.

board note of fawip-bagaf: The steering committee signed off on a budget of $408.9 million for Project Zorys.